当前位置:实例文章 » HTML/CSS实例» [文章]opencv环境搭建

opencv环境搭建

发布人:shili8 发布时间:2024-12-30 04:43 阅读次数:0

**OpenCV 环境搭建指南**

**前言**

OpenCV(Open Source Computer Vision Library)是世界上最流行的计算机视觉库。它提供了大量的函数和工具来处理图像、视频等多媒体数据。OpenCV 的环境搭建对于进行计算机视觉相关研究或开发工作至关重要。本文将指导您一步步地搭建 OpenCV 环境。

**系统要求**

* 操作系统:Windows10 或 Linux(Ubuntu18.04 或更高版本)
* CPU:Intel Core i5 或 AMD Ryzen5* 内存:8 GB RAM* 硬盘空间:至少1 TB**安装 OpenCV**

### Windows 安装1. **下载 OpenCV**:前往 [OpenCV 官网]( "Downloads",选择适合您的操作系统和 CPU 架构的包。
2. **解压 OpenCV**:将下载好的包解压到一个目录中(例如 `C:OpenCV`)。
3. **配置环境变量**:
* 右键单击 "开始"菜单,选择 "系统",然后点击 "高级系统设置"。
* 在 "系统属性"窗口中,单击 "环境变量"。
* 在 "系统变量"下,找到 "Path",然后单击 "编辑"。
* 在 "编辑环境变量"窗口中,单击 "新建",输入 `C:OpenCVbin`(或您的 OpenCV 安装目录),然后点击 "确定"。
4. **测试 OpenCV**:
* 打开命令行终端,输入 `opencv_version --version`,如果成功,则会输出 OpenCV 的版本信息。

### Linux 安装1. **更新包索引**:运行 `sudo apt update`。
2. **安装 OpenCV**:运行 `sudo apt install libopencv-dev`。
3. **配置环境变量**:
* 编辑 `~/.bashrc` 文件(或您的 shell 配置文件),添加以下行:`export PATH=$PATH:/usr/local/bin/`
*保存并关闭文件,然后重新启动终端。
4. **测试 OpenCV**:
* 打开命令行终端,输入 `opencv_version --version`,如果成功,则会输出 OpenCV 的版本信息。

**使用 OpenCV**

### Python 使用1. **安装 OpenCV-Python**:运行 `pip install opencv-python`。
2. **导入 OpenCV 库**:在 Python 脚本中,添加以下行:`import cv2`
3. **读取图像**:使用 `cv2.imread()` 函数读取图像文件,例如:`img = cv2.imread('image.jpg')`

### C++ 使用1. **安装 OpenCV-C++**:运行 `sudo apt install libopencv-dev`(或您的系统包管理器)。
2. **导入 OpenCV 库**:在 C++ 脚本中,添加以下行:`#include `
3. **读取图像**:使用 `cv::imread()` 函数读取图像文件,例如:`cv::Mat img = cv::imread('image.jpg')`

**总结**

OpenCV 环境搭建是一个简单的过程。通过遵循本文提供的步骤,您可以在 Windows 或 Linux 系统上安装 OpenCV,并使用 Python 或 C++ 等语言进行计算机视觉相关开发工作。

相关标签:node.jswebpack前端
其他信息

其他资源

Top